SpringBoot
folinggg
这个作者很懒,什么都没留下…
展开
-
SpringBoot项目部署有关问题
Jar包与War包在部署项目的时候,我们需要选择将项目打包成jar包还是war包。取决于Spring Boot项目所使用的Tomcat是内嵌的还是单独的。如果使用内嵌的Tomcat,那么推荐打包成Jar包,在打包时会将Tomcat包一起打包。如果使用单独的Tomcat,那么推荐打包成War包,这样将war包放入到Tomcat的Webapps目录下后,启动bin目录下的startup.sh 即可如何打包打包Jar包IDEA在项目的pom.xml下添加<packaging>j原创 2022-05-24 10:11:50 · 104 阅读 · 0 评论 -
使用thymeleaf在url中传递多个参数
起先因为不会用,所以使用的方式为:<a th:href="@{/deleteTeach/{sno}/{cno}/(cno=${teach.cno},sno=${teach.sno})}" type="button">删除</a>相应的controller为: @GetMapping("/deleteTeach/{sno}/{cno}") public String deleteTeach(@PathVarialbe("cno)Long cno,@PathVari原创 2021-07-01 15:04:10 · 893 阅读 · 1 评论 -
使用SpringBoot实现数据库管理系统解决的错误
There is no getter for property named ‘id’ in ‘class com.baomidou.mybatisplus.core.conditions.query.QueryWrapper’数据库中的id为自增id。所以需要在实体类对应的id上加入**@TableId(type=IdType.AUTO)**原创 2021-06-12 23:58:18 · 157 阅读 · 1 评论 -
自动装配
3.1、引导加载自动配置类1.@SpringBootConfiguration@Configuration:代表当前是一个配置类2.@ComponentScan指定扫描哪些,Spring注解;3.@EnableAutoConfiguration合成注解1、@AutoConfigurationPackage自动配置包2、@Import(AutoConfigurationImportSelector.class)给容器批量导入组件3.2、按需开启自动配置项所有自动配置启动的时候默认全部加原创 2021-05-01 21:13:49 · 114 阅读 · 0 评论